55 from CO
no reads, ok not to c-bet this? scary board..
Full Tilt Poker - No Limit Hold'em Cash Game - $0.10/$0.25 Blinds - 6 Players - (LegoPoker HH Converter) SB: $23.25 BB: $12.40 UTG: $54.95 MP: $24.70 <font color="black">Hero (CO): $30.05</font> BTN: $29.65 <font color="black">Preflop:</font> Hero is dealt 5[img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img] 5[img]/images/graemlins/diamond.gif[/img] (6 Players) 2 folds, <font color="red">Hero raises to $1</font>, BTN calls $1, 2 folds <font color="black">Flop:</font> ($2.35) Q[img]/images/graemlins/diamond.gif[/img] 3[img]/images/graemlins/club.gif[/img] K[img]/images/graemlins/diamond.gif[/img] (2 Players) Hero checks, BTN checks <font color="black">Turn:</font> ($2.35) T[img]/images/graemlins/diamond.gif[/img] (2 Players) Hero checks, BTN checks <font color="black">River:</font> ($2.35) 8[img]/images/graemlins/club.gif[/img] (2 Players) Hero checks, BTN checks Pot Size: $2.35 ($0.10 Rake) |

Re: 55 from CO
I'd still c-bet it nearly always. If I've got a read that he'll call with anything reasonable, he's a floater or something, or I've been c-betting a lot and not getting called -- eh, I might not. Default is still to bet it w/o special circumstances.
That's a scary flop for your villain too. I don't think it's much of a mistake either way. |
